Job Description

Job Summary Join our dynamic veterinary team as a Part-Time Registered Vet Tech, where your expertise will directly contribute to providing exceptional animal care and support. In this vital role, you will assist veterinarians with clinical procedures, animal handling, and diagnostic testing, ensuring a smooth and efficient workflow. Your passion for animals and attention to detail will help create a compassionate environment where pets receive the highest quality care. This position offers flexible hours for motivated individuals eager to make a positive impact in veterinary medicine. Responsibilities Assist veterinarians during examinations, surgeries, and diagnostic procedures with animal restraint and handling techniques. Perform laboratory tests, including sample collection, processing, and analysis to support accurate diagnoses. Maintain aseptic techniques during procedures such as animal catheterization and wound management to prevent infection. Conduct dental cleanings and understand dental terminology to support oral health treatments. Operate X-ray equipment safely, interpret radiographs, and assist with imaging procedures involving animal physiology. Support veterinary critical care efforts by monitoring vital signs, administering treatments, and assisting with emergency protocols. Manage animal restraint using proper techniques for various species including dogs, cats, and equines. Maintain detailed medical records, laboratory logs, and treatment documentation accurately. Skills Proven kennel experience combined with animal handling skills across different species. Strong understanding of veterinary terminology, animal anatomy, and physiology. Experience with laboratory procedures, X-ray operation, and veterinary critical care practices. Knowledge of dental terminology, pet grooming techniques, and aseptic surgical methods. Ability to perform animal catheterization and apply proper restraint techniques effectively. Familiarity with equine care practices is a plus; dog training experience is highly valued. Excellent communication skills for collaborating with team members and educating pet owners about pet care needs.
